    Specifications General Power Requirement 12 to 15 VDC, 150 mA nominal System Frequency Response 200 to 4.5 kHz ±3 dB Environmental -20° C to 55° C, 0% to 90% humidity, non-condensing Outputs External Speaker 2W: 100dB SPL at 1ft. at 1 kHz, C weighting Internal Speaker 2W: 100dB SPL at 1ft.

    Installation Installation Remove the two screws (one on each side) holding the mounting plate to the operator assembly. (See Figure 2 .) Measure and identify the location where the intercom is to be mounted. Attach the mounting template to the window (customer assembly side) being sure to center the appropriate guide in the location identified in step 2.
